KFSHRC To Showcase Leading Healthcare Innovations At Arab Health 2025 In Dubai
King Faisal Specialist Hospital and Research Centre (KFSHRC) is set to participate in the Arab Health 2025 event in Dubai from January 27 to 30. At its booth, KFSHRC will present its pioneering healthcare innovations and solutions. The hospital's specialized Centers of Excellence in Oncology, Organ Transplantation, Cardiology, and Genomics have gained a strong reputation both regionally and globally.
The event is anticipated to attract over 60,000 visitors, highlighting KFSHRC’s dedication to exploring new healthcare trends and envisioning future advancements. This participation underscores its role as a leader in healthcare innovation locally and internationally. Among its notable achievements are the world’s first fully robotic heart transplant and local T-cell production, which reduces costs linked to international manufacturing.

KFSHRC's Deputy Chief Executive Officer Dr. Björn Zoëga will be part of a panel discussion titled "Investing in KSA’s Healthcare Future: Achieving Vision 2030." He will discuss the hospital's innovations in specialized healthcare and their influence on advancing medical tourism in Saudi Arabia. This aligns with KFSHRC’s vision of becoming a global hub for specialized healthcare.
The hospital aims to attract 5% of patients who seek treatment abroad by offering advanced technologies and services. Serving patients from 17 countries, including 77% from the GCC, KFSHRC positions itself as the top choice for accurate diagnoses and advanced treatments.
KFSHRC has been ranked first in the Middle East and Africa and 20th globally among the world’s top 250 academic medical centers for two consecutive years. It has also been recognized as the most valuable healthcare brand in Saudi Arabia and the Middle East according to Brand Finance's 2024 rankings.
Additionally, Newsweek magazine included KFSHRC in its World’s Best Smart Hospitals list for 2025. These accolades affirm its commitment to excellence in healthcare delivery and innovation.
